RTP and Volatility Analysis

Return to Player (RTP) and volatility are essential factors to consider when choosing games to play on non-registered sites. RTP refers to the percentage of wagered money that a slot machine or casino game will pay back to players over time. High RTP games offer better odds of winning, while low RTP games have a higher house edge. Volatility, on the other hand, measures the risk associated with a particular game. Low volatility games provide frequent but small wins, while high volatility games offer less frequent but larger payouts.
